Building a Strong Brand Foundation

For a casino operator, the first step in constructing brand presence is consistency. That means a recognizable logo, clear promotional tone, unified visual style, and above all, reliability in every transaction and communication. You could compare it to walking into a real-world casino you trust. You know the lights, the scent, the sound of slot machines—all are familiar and evoke a sense of belonging. A digital platform should deliver that same consistency through its design language and service delivery.

Trust Anchors: From Registration to Withdrawal

The registration process can be the first real encounter a player has with a casino’s integrity. A streamlined sign-up page that feels professional and secure speaks volumes. Payments, too, are part of brand trust. When withdrawals work smoothly, players talk about it. When they don’t, they really talk about it. In a way, every micro-interaction, from account creation to customer support chat, reinforces or erodes brand presence.

The Role of Transparency

Transparency is at the heart of brand credibility. Casinos that explain their bonus terms clearly, show RTP rates, and provide accessible support stand out. It’s not even about perfection; players forgive occasional hiccups as long as they’re handled honestly. Ironically, this openness reinforces strength.

Retention Through Experience Personalization

Another anchor of loyalty lies in personalization. When an online casino tailors bonuses to match a player’s previous habits—like offering free spins for favorite slot genres or custom cashback on weekends—the interaction feels personal. In a sea of generic offers, tailored rewards create a “they remembered me” moment that strengthens connection.

Technological Underpinnings

Behind the scenes, machine learning helps identify such personalization opportunities. Yet technology should never override tone. A robotic message offering “bonus detected for your play pattern” contrasts harshly against conversational branding. The key is merging analytics with human warmth.
